In Mandarin Chinese, the pin yin word “Jia-You” literally means “add oil” or “add fuel,” essentially, “give it more gas.” It’s the equivalent of : “Hang in there, you can do it, go for it!” When you start to fatigue, Jia-You means to focus, remember your purpose, and give it your all.
